Transferring Your WordPress Website: A Step-by-Step Guide
Wiki Article
Relocating your The WordPress website can seem intimidating, but with a thorough plan, it’s a achievable endeavor. This guide walks you through the necessary steps for a smooth transition. First, select a new hosting provider and establish your account. Then, backup your complete blog, including files and the database. You can use tools like All-in-One WP Migration or employ your server’s migration tools. Next, copy the content to website transfer your new hosting environment. Finally, restore the records and update your domain name servers to point to your latest server. Remember to test your site thoroughly afterward to ensure everything is operational.

Transferring Your The WordPress Site to a Different Server
So, you’re planning to transfer your WP blog to a fresh server? It's a typical task, but can seem complex if you're not experienced. Generally, the process includes creating a copy of your data and data store , then transferring them to your new server . You can choose a manual method involving FTP and phpMyAdmin, or leverage a WordPress that streamlines the migration process. Regardless of the approach you select , remember to duplicate everything initially to safeguard against any potential difficulties.
